3D File Formats Compatibility

Polygonal 3D Models

Downloadable formats:

.max, .obj, .fbx, .blend, .c4d

Compatible with:

3ds Max, Blender, Maya, Cinema 4D, Houdini, Modo, Unity, Unreal Engine, SketchUp, Substance 3D, ZBrush and more.

Exportable formats:

3D Studio Legacy (.3ds), AutoCAD (.dxf; .dwg), Alembic (.abc), Rhino (.3dm), SketchUp (.skp), Collada (.dae), Stereolithography (.stl), DirectX (.x), Graphics Library Transmission Format (.glb; .gltf), Universal Scene Description (.usd; .usdz), Virtual Reality Modeling Language (.vrml; .wrl), Extensible 3D (.x3d)

CAD Solid Models

Downloadable formats:

.step (AP214), .iges (5.3)

Compatible with:

SolidWorks, Inventor, Creo, Siemens NX, Fusion 360, Solid Edge, Plasticity, Rhinoceros, CATIA, ACIS and other CAD/CAM/CAE software.

CAD models can also be exported as polygonal 3D meshes.
